Centos7卸载FastDFS6.1卸载(六)
今天由于安装了高版本的fastdfs,与nginx不兼容,因此要卸载掉,重新安装。
转载:http://www.leftso.com/blog/244.html
) 停止服务
[root@bogon fdfs]#service fdfs_trackerd stop
[root@bogon fdfs]#service fdfs_storaged stop
2) 通过storage.conf找到base_path和store_path然后删除
[root@bogon fdfs]# cat /etc/fdfs/storage.conf |grep base_path
base_path=/opt/fastdfs_storage
# store_path#, based 0, if store_path0 not exists, it's value is base_path
[root@bogon fdfs]#
[root@bogon fdfs]# cat /etc/fdfs/storage.conf |grep store_path
store_path_count=1
# store_path#, based 0, if store_path0 not exists, it's value is base_path
store_path0=/opt/fastdfs_storage_data
#store_path1=/home/yuqing/fastdfs2
# store_path (disk), value can be 1 to 256, default value is 256
[root@bogon fdfs]#
删除上面标红的路径,
注意,如果有未备份的文件,请先备份再删除
[root@bogon fdfs]# rm -rf /opt/fastdfs_storage
[root@bogon fdfs]# rm -rf /opt/fastdfs_storage_data
3) 通过tracker.conf找到base_path然后删除
[root@bogon fdfs]# cat /etc/fdfs/tracker.conf |grep base_path
base_path=/opt/fastdfs_tracker
[root@bogon fdfs]#rm –rf /opt/fastdfs_tracker
4) 删除配置文件目录
[root@bogon ~]# pwd
/root
[root@bogon ~]# rm -rf /etc/fdfs/
[root@bogon ~]#
5) 删除链接文件
删除tracker的链接文件
#rm –rf /usr/local/bin/fdfs_trackerd
#rm –rf /usr/local/bin/stop.sh
#rm –rf /usr/local/bin/restart.sh
删除storage的链接文件
#rm –rf /usr/local/bin/fdfs_storaged
6) 删除/usr/bin目录下FastDFS的可执行文件
首先通过ls命令查看文件,然后删除
[root@bogon ~]# ll /usr/bin/fdfs_*
-rwxr-xr-x. 1 root root 262099 Jul 27 03:01 /usr/bin/fdfs_appender_test
-rwxr-xr-x. 1 root root 261796 Jul 27 03:01 /usr/bin/fdfs_appender_test1
-rwxr-xr-x. 1 root root 252140 Jul 27 03:01 /usr/bin/fdfs_append_file
-rwxr-xr-x. 1 root root 251274 Jul 27 03:01 /usr/bin/fdfs_crc32
-rwxr-xr-x. 1 root root 252223 Jul 27 03:01 /usr/bin/fdfs_delete_file
-rwxr-xr-x. 1 root root 253062 Jul 27 03:01 /usr/bin/fdfs_download_file
-rwxr-xr-x. 1 root root 252756 Jul 27 03:01 /usr/bin/fdfs_file_info
-rwxr-xr-x. 1 root root 265444 Jul 27 03:01 /usr/bin/fdfs_monitor
-rwxr-xr-x. 1 root root 878573 Jul 27 03:01 /usr/bin/fdfs_storaged
-rwxr-xr-x. 1 root root 268499 Jul 27 03:01 /usr/bin/fdfs_test
-rwxr-xr-x. 1 root root 267636 Jul 27 03:01 /usr/bin/fdfs_test1
-rwxr-xr-x. 1 root root 374059 Jul 27 03:01 /usr/bin/fdfs_tracker
-rwxr-xr-x. 1 root root 253166 Jul 27 03:01 /usr/bin/fdfs_upload_appender
-rwxr-xr-x. 1 root root 254296 Jul 27 03:01 /usr/bin/fdfs_upload_file
[root@bogon ~]#

看到全是FastDFS的文件,删除:
[root@bogon ~]# rm -rf /usr/bin/fdfs_*
[root@bogon ~]#
7) 删除/usr/include/目录下FastDFS相关的shell脚本
首先查看文件:
[root@bogon ~]# ll /usr/include/fastdfs/*
-rw-r--r--. 1 root root 3752 Jul 27 03:01 /usr/include/fastdfs/client_func.h
-rw-r--r--. 1 root root 794 Jul 27 03:01 /usr/include/fastdfs/client_global.h
-rw-r--r--. 1 root root 531 Jul 27 03:01 /usr/include/fastdfs/fdfs_client.h
-rw-r--r--. 1 root root 946 Jul 27 03:01 /usr/include/fastdfs/fdfs_define.h
-rw-r--r--. 1 root root 1005 Jul 27 03:01 /usr/include/fastdfs/fdfs_global.h
-rw-r--r--. 1 root root 3117 Jul 27 03:01 /usr/include/fastdfs/fdfs_http_shared.h
-rw-r--r--. 1 root root 2699 Jul 27 03:01 /usr/include/fastdfs/fdfs_shared_func.h
-rw-r--r--. 1 root root 990 Jul 27 03:01 /usr/include/fastdfs/mime_file_parser.h
-rw-r--r--. 1 root root 20104 Jul 27 03:01 /usr/include/fastdfs/storage_client1.h
-rw-r--r--. 1 root root 21755 Jul 27 03:01 /usr/include/fastdfs/storage_client.h
-rw-r--r--. 1 root root 11555 Jul 27 03:01 /usr/include/fastdfs/tracker_client.h
-rw-r--r--. 1 root root 11983 Jul 27 03:01 /usr/include/fastdfs/tracker_proto.h
-rw-r--r--. 1 root root 14349 Jul 27 03:01 /usr/include/fastdfs/tracker_types.h
-rw-r--r--. 1 root root 6945 Jul 27 03:01 /usr/include/fastdfs/trunk_shared.h
[root@bogon ~]#

删除:
[root@bogon ~]# rm -rf /usr/include/fastdfs/
[root@bogon ~]#
8) 删除/usr/lib64目录下的库文件
查看:
[root@bogon lib64]# ll libfdfsclient*
-rwxr-xr-x. 1 root root 255538 Jul 27 03:01 libfdfsclient.so
删除:
[root@bogon lib64]# rm -rf libfdfsclient*
9) 删除/usr/lib/目录下的库
查看:
[root@bogon lib64]# ll libfdfsclient*
-rwxr-xr-x. 1 root root 255538 Jul 27 03:01 libfdfsclient.so
删除:
[root@bogon lib64]# rm -rf libfdfsclient*
经过以上步骤,FastDFS已经卸载。
Centos7卸载FastDFS6.1卸载(六)的更多相关文章
- Centos7下PHP的卸载与安装nginx
Centos7下PHP的卸载与安装nginx CentOS上PHP完全卸载,想把PHP卸载干净,直接用yum的remove命令是不行的,需要查看有多少rpm包,然后按照依赖顺序逐一卸载. 1.首先查看 ...
- CentOS7 nginx安装与卸载
简明清晰,易操作,参照: CentOS7 nginx安装与卸载
- ceph的正常卸载与非正常卸载
一.ceph的正常卸载与非正常卸载 一.正常卸载(通过ceph-deploy卸载) 环境已安装ceph-deploy 1.查看ceph-deploy的帮助信息 [cephde@controller03 ...
- 卸载、指定卸载 .NET Core Runtime and SDK
原文:卸载.指定卸载 .NET Core Runtime and SDK 项目使用的 Nuget 包,比如 Microsoft.AspNetCore.App等的版本号要与 .NET Core 版本号( ...
- Centos7下安装与卸载docker应用容器引擎
Docker 是一个开源的应用容器引擎,基于 Go 语言 并遵从Apache2.0协议开源. Docker 可以让开发者打包他们的应用以及依赖包到一个轻量级.可移植的容器中,然后发布到任何流行的 Li ...
- CentOS7中Docker-ce的卸载和安装
一.查看是否已安装了Docker软件包: #查看是否已经安装的Docker软件包sudo yum list installed | grep docker 二.如果已安装不想要的docker/dock ...
- centos7安装Jenkins及其卸载
首先安装好Java(Java_home) 查看Java版本 # java -version 如果没安装,依照以下我的另一篇博客进行安装 https://www.cnblogs.com/djlsunsh ...
- 【CentOS】CentOS7.0 mysql与卸载
mysql安装: 在使用命令 yum list mysql-server 安装mysql的时候,发现没有mysql的包.这时候,我们需要下载一个 下载包 wget http://repo.mysql. ...
- Centos7下安装与卸载Jdk1.8
安装 去官网下载jdk:http://www.oracle.com/technetwork/java/javase/downloads/jdk8-downloads-2133151.html 使用xs ...
随机推荐
- border-radius 如何计算
1.使用px: 圆的半径是那个px值大小 用这个圆放到div的角上去切割div 2.使用%: 如果长度和宽度一样 圆的半径是长度乘这个百分比得到的结果 如果长度和宽度不一样 产生的效果是宽高乘以百分数 ...
- 测开之路九十八:js变量和语句
这里为了方便调试,在jsbin网站上面编写js脚本:https://jsbin.com/?js,console 可以点击增加/减少对应展示分页,Console为控制台部分,Output为页面部分 变量 ...
- Delphi 遍历类中的属性
http://blog.csdn.net/easyboot/article/details/8004954 Delphi 遍历类中的属性 标签: delphistringbuttonclassform ...
- 券商VIP交易通道
打新不成就炒新.随着新股发行上市的再次重启,巨大的获利机会引来投资者的争相竞逐,可并非所有投资者都能抢到新股筹码.“每天都在涨停板追这些新股,但从来没有买到过.”证券时报记者在采访中听到不少中小散户如 ...
- JVM可视化监控工具jconsole以及jvisualvm的配置
使用jdk自带的jconsole.jvisualvm插件,监控远程linux服务器中tomcat的jvm情况 (jconsole.jvisualvm插件可查看堆内存变化情况,线程状态,CPU使用情况, ...
- Mybatis-学习笔记(1)SqlSessionFactory、SqlSession、Mybatis配置文件configuration的属性标签
1.mybatis引入项目,只需要引入mybatis-x.x.x.jar包即可. (当然数据库驱动的引入必不可少) 2.SqlSessionFactory 由SqlSessionFactoryBuil ...
- 初探LINUX之--基础知识篇
一 Linux哲学思想 1 一切都是一个文件(包含硬件) 2 小型,单一用途的程序 3 链接程序,共同完成复杂的任务 4 避免令人困惑的用户界面 5 配置数据存储在文本中 二 Linux重要概念 Sh ...
- C89标准和C99标准C11标准的区别
转载 C89标准和C99标准C11标准的区别 C99对C89的改变 1.增加restrict指针 C99中增加了公适用于指针的restrict类型修饰符,它是初始访问指针所指对象的惟一途径,因此只有借 ...
- python 迭代器和生成器的区别
迭代器(iterator)是一个实现了迭代器协议的对象,python的一些内置数据类型(列表,数组,字符串,字典等)都可以通过for语句进行迭代,我们也可以自己创建一个容器,实现了迭代器协议,可以通过 ...
- 魔板 (bfs+康托展开)
# 10027. 「一本通 1.4 例 2」魔板 [题目描述] Rubik 先生在发明了风靡全球魔方之后,又发明了它的二维版本--魔板.这是一张有 888 个大小相同的格子的魔板: 1 2 3 4 8 ...